Tripura Cabinet Moves to Regularise Ad-Hoc Promotion Policy for State Employees


The state government has decided to regularise the ad-hoc promotion policy introduced in 2021 for its employees. Minister Sushanta Chowdhury announced the decision during a press conference at the Secretariat on Monday evening.

Minister Sushanta Chowdhury said the government had adopted the ad-hoc promotion system because a related case on service promotions was pending before the Supreme Court. Under this temporary policy, more than 13,082 state government employees received ad-hoc promotions up to June 2025.

He noted that employees who retired after receiving ad-hoc promotions had been suffering financial disadvantages. Considering the overall situation and the welfare of its workforce, the government has decided to extend the benefits of regularisation to all employees, including those already retired.

Chowdhury clarified that the Cabinet’s decision will be implemented subject to the final outcome of the ongoing Supreme Court case.
